Commit Message

AKASHI Takahiro July 22, 2020, 6:05 a.m. UTC
In this commit, skeleton functions for capsule-related API's are
added under CONFIG_EFI_UPDATE_CAPSULE configuration.
Detailed implementation for a specific capsule type will be added
in the succeeding patches.
